Transaction 8581bd90305af812865c73f3e94bbea397aa1c4fa72d06ffae604fa39eed37e0

1 Input
2 Outputs
  • 8581bd90305af812865c73f3e94bbea397aa1c4fa72d06ffae604fa39eed37e0:0
  • value  348132
    address  2MtpTGBJiWL85hkVg649UAL1NCn3SmCQPap
  • 8581bd90305af812865c73f3e94bbea397aa1c4fa72d06ffae604fa39eed37e0:1
  • value  9416785438
    address  2N68AAidfjYgzKW9Wnj2GknVKicehaTFZA5